O God, we want to praise and thank you
for giving us so much to enjoy in your world.
Open our eyes to see all the beauty around us,
to appreciate your greatness in giving us the different seasons,
each fulfilling our needs.
And if we do not understand why nature is sometimes cruel and harsh
and why people suffer from earthquakes and other disasters in your world,
help us to trust where we cannot see,
knowing that you love us all.
Help us to do what we can to relieve the sufferings and hardships
caused by these disasters and those caused by human errors.
Make us willing and eager to share the many good things you have provided
for the benefit of all.
Nancy Martin

I am the Lord, and there is no other;
apart from me there is no God.
I will strengthen you,
though you have not acknowledged me,
so that from the rising of the sun
to the place of its setting
people may know there is none besides me.
I am the Lord, and there is no other.
I form the light and create darkness,
I bring prosperity and create disaster;
I, the Lord, do all these things.
You heavens above, rain down my righteousness;
let the clouds shower it down.
Let the earth open wide,
let salvation spring up,
let righteousness flourish with it;
I, the Lord, have created it.
